- who: Peter Trosan and colleagues from the Charles University and General University Hospital in Prague, Prague, Czech Republic have published the research work: Interleukin-13 increases the stemness of limbal epithelial stem cells cultures, in the Journal: PLOS ONE of 29/Nov/2021
- what: This study showed that IL13 enhanced the stemness of LECs by increasing the clonogenicity and the expression of putative stem cell markers of LECs while maintaining their stem cell morphology.
